Matt Lindland Explains UFC's Refusal To Sign Him
Posted by Dustin James on 02.15.2008



Top ranked Middleweight Matt Lindland recently had an interview with TAGG Radio where he explained the current situation regarding Lindland signing with the UFC:

On UFC contract negotiations:

"I made it very clear to Dana (White), and he's the final decision-maker on all that stuff, I made it very clear that I was looking for them to make me an offer. I said, ‘Make me an offer, and let's talk. Let's do business.' I got back a, ‘We're not going to make you any kind of an offer' response."

On who told Lindland the UFC wouldn't sign him:

"Joe (Silva, UFC matchmaker) actually responded back to me and said, ‘Dana is not going to make you an offer of any kind."

On why he was fired from the UFC sometime ago:

(Note: It is said that the UFC fired Lindland for wearing an unapproved sponsor's t-shirt during weigh-ins.)

"There's a lot of other people that had similar sponsors, or unapproved sponsors, (and they) weren't suspended, They didn't fire me for doing that. They fired me the next day after I fought. You know, I didn't wear the sponsor into the ring. There's guys that have worn similar sponsors — or even the same company — into the ring that didn't get fired. I didn't wear it into the ring. I wore it at the weigh-ins.

On what happened with him & BodogFights and why he has been inactive for almost a year:

"It was because I had a contract with (BodogFIGHT) that they were in breach of. They failed to fulfill their obligation to me to get me my other two fights… I'll probably never see that money. They set themselves up as a shell company. BodogFIGHT is not the same as Bodog, the billion-dollar Internet gaming company."

On his current IFL team he coaches:

"We have a team fighting the 29th of this month at Las Vegas, You want to call us the (Portland) Wolfpack? That's the theme you want to go with? That's fine. I always thought that we should be Team Quest."

Matt Lindland may be best known as one of the founders of Team Quest in Portland, Oregon along with Randy Couture. Lindland also currently owns the Portland-based "Sportfight" organization.
